Rapid Eye Movement (REM) sleep behavior disorder: A sleep disturbance affecting mainly older men
Abstract: Rapid Eye Movement (REM) sleep behavior disorder is characterized by the intermittent loss of REM-related muscle atonia and the appearance of elaborated motor behaviors (sometimes violent behavior) and vocalizations associated with dream mentation. Nine patients were diagnosed in our ...
